| As the background of application in the field of health care,the flexible interaction between patients and medical system is well provided in the medical cyber-physical systems,thus realizing the omni-directional three-dimensional medical service.Physical space(including user space)and cyber space(including network space)are the basic structure of medical cyber-physical systems.Its physical basis is physical space,including all kinds of hard real-time perception health equipment,health diagnosis and treatment equipment and user space composed of various users.Cyber space is the core component of medical cyberphysical systems,which is responsible for the storage,processing and security access management of users and health information.However,a large number of users with different roles and different types of health equipment are included in the physical space,including illegal users and devices.According to the requirements of controllable and credible medical cyber-physical systems,it requires that the medical cyber-physical systems have a safe and reliable security identity authentication mechanism,so as to build a security barrier of medical cyber-physical systems.In this thesis,two key issues of medical cyber-physical systems oriented security user identity authentication and security device identity authentication are studied.Based on blockchain technology,a security authentication method for medical cyber-physical systems is proposed.The main work and innovation of this thesis are as follows:1.Based on the characteristics of blockchain,such as non tamperability and anti retroactivity,this thesis studies the decentralized security authentication protocol between users and between users,between users and services,to ensure the accuracy and efficiency of cross domain authentication and realize the security authentication between users.2.We identify the device node with multi-attribute ID and study the strict device authentication mechanism,and combine the blockchain technology to prevent malicious nodes from joining,so as to prevent the devices in the physical space from misleading and damaging the cyber space data.In order to replace the traditional trusted third-party authentication method,we build a federation chain model for blockchain nodes,which only aims at specific objects and limited third parties.At the same time,according to the analysis of the authentication scheme,the validity and feasibility of the proposed security authentication scheme are verified by using random oracle and BAN logic. |